You And Me Poem by Jacson Gelato

You And Me

Rating: 4.3


By color, creed, race and speech
all men God created equal.
Though some in some land
have their own homes and faith;
Traditions bind them together
marriages occur as man prospers
children that are born
carry on this World endlessly;
among those that live
on this planet
are you and me
who help life to go on;
shouldn't the Earth
be happy to have us
just as we are happy
to have this world
to explore and conquer
our every dream
our every wish.
